What is Cu clip package? copper brass

Power chips are attached to external circuits with packaging, and their performance depends on the assistance of the product packaging. In high-power scenarios, power chips are typically packaged as power components. Chip affiliation refers to the electrical link on the upper surface area of the chip, which is typically aluminum bonding cord in typical components. ^
Standard power component package cross-section

Today, industrial silicon carbide power modules still mainly make use of the packaging modern technology of this wire-bonded traditional silicon IGBT module. They encounter issues such as big high-frequency parasitic criteria, not enough heat dissipation ability, low-temperature resistance, and insufficient insulation strength, which restrict using silicon carbide semiconductors. In order to solve these problems and totally make use of the huge prospective benefits of silicon carbide chips, numerous brand-new product packaging modern technologies and remedies for silicon carbide power modules have actually emerged in recent years.

Silicon carbide power module bonding technique


(Figure (a) Wire bonding and (b) Cu Clip power module structure diagram (left) copper wire and (right) copper strip connection process)

Bonding materials have actually created from gold wire bonding in 2001 to light weight aluminum cord (tape) bonding in 2006, copper cable bonding in 2011, and Cu Clip bonding in 2016. Low-power devices have actually developed from gold wires to copper wires, and the driving force is expense decrease; high-power devices have actually created from light weight aluminum wires (strips) to Cu Clips, and the driving pressure is to enhance item efficiency. The better the power, the greater the demands.

Cu Clip is copper strip, copper sheet. Clip Bond, or strip bonding, is a packaging procedure that utilizes a solid copper bridge soldered to solder to connect chips and pins. Compared to conventional bonding product packaging methods, Cu Clip technology has the complying with advantages:

1. The connection in between the chip and the pins is made from copper sheets, which, to a certain extent, replaces the common cord bonding technique between the chip and the pins. As a result, a special package resistance value, higher current flow, and much better thermal conductivity can be acquired.

2. The lead pin welding area does not require to be silver-plated, which can fully conserve the cost of silver plating and bad silver plating.

3. The item look is entirely consistent with typical products and is mostly utilized in web servers, portable computers, batteries/drives, graphics cards, electric motors, power supplies, and various other areas.

Cu Clip has two bonding methods.

All copper sheet bonding method

Both the Gate pad and the Resource pad are clip-based. This bonding method is more pricey and intricate, however it can accomplish much better Rdson and much better thermal impacts.


( copper strip)

Copper sheet plus wire bonding method

The source pad utilizes a Clip technique, and the Gate uses a Cord approach. This bonding approach is somewhat more affordable than the all-copper bonding technique, saving wafer location (suitable to extremely little entrance areas). The procedure is easier than the all-copper bonding technique and can acquire better Rdson and better thermal effect.
